James Eberwine - Curriculum Vitae#


Elmer Holmes Bobst Professor of Systems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ics
Co-Director of the PENN Program in Single Cell Biology

Education:
  • 1978 B.S. Yale University (Biochemistry)
  • 1979 M.A. Columbia University (Biochemistry)
  • 1984 Ph.D.

Postgraduate Training:
  • Columbia University (Biochemistry)
  • 1984 - 1986 Nancy Pritzker Laboratory, Behavioral Neurochemistry,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ences, Stanford University School of Medicine
  • 1986 - 1989 Research Associate and Head, Section of Molecular Neurobiology

Former Faculty Appointments:
  • Nancy Pritzker Laboratory of Behavioral Neurochemistry
  • 1990 - 1994 Assistant Professor, Department of Pharmacology,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ine
  • 1990 - 1994 Assistant Professor of Pharmacology in Psychiatry,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ine
  • 1994 - 1996 Associate Professor, Department of Pharmacology,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ine
  • 1994 - 1996 Associate Professor of Pharmacology in Psychiatry,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ine
  • 1996 - present Professor, Department of Pharmacology,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ine
  • 1996 - present Professor of Pharmacology in Psychiatry,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ine
  • 2006 - 2017 Adjunct Professor, Scripps Research Institute – Department of Chemical Physiology
  • 2006 - present Elmer Holmes Bobst Chair in Systems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ics, UPENN
  • 2017 - 2020 Adjunct Professor, Scripps Research Institute – Department of Molecular Medicine
  • 2018 - 2020 Distinguished Visiting Professor, Departmemt of Genetics, Shanghai Jiao Tong University

Scientometric data: Number of publications: 255, H index: 76, citations over 25000.

Scientific contributions: Linear amplification, Single Cell Molecular biology of organells :Mitochondrial biology studies of genotype -phenotype connection as expressed via changes in the transcriptome and proteome.

Teaching: Organizer of several national and international training programs, supervisor of several PhD students, Regular curses in several universities.

Awards: Received 25 awards

Memberships: 1990-present Society for Neuroscience, 1990-present John Morgan Society, 1992-present American Society for Neurochemistry, 2014-present National Academy of Inventors, 2019-present National Academy of Medicine
